Chinese Ideal Weight Formula and Mathematical Explanation

The calculation for Chinese ideal weight typically builds upon the standard BMI formula but often incorporates adjustments for sex and age, and aims for a specific, often slightly narrower, BMI range considered optimal for East Asian populations. A commonly cited approach involves using the BMI range of 18.5 to 23.9 as a healthy target, a slight modification from some Western guidelines which might extend the upper limit. However, simpler empirical formulas are also used, especially for quick estimations.

One such empirical formula, adjusted for sex, can be represented as:

  • For Men: Ideal Weight (kg) = 0.75 * [Height (cm) – 150] + 50
  • For Women: Ideal Weight (kg) = 0.7 * [Height (cm) – 150] + 48

These formulas provide a baseline "ideal" weight. To establish an ideal weight range, we typically consider a ±10% variation around this baseline, or more accurately, a range corresponding to a healthy BMI (18.5 to 23.9). This calculator uses the BMI-based approach for a more scientifically grounded range.

Variables Used:

Variable Meaning Unit Typical Range
Height Individual's height Centimeters (cm) 140 – 190+ cm
Age Individual's age Years 18 – 80+ years
Sex Biological sex (Male/Female) Categorical Male, Female
BMI Body Mass Index (Weight in kg / Height in m²) kg/m² 18.5 – 23.9 (Healthy for East Asians)
Ideal Weight Target weight for health and well-being Kilograms (kg) Varies based on height/sex

The calculation within this Chinese Ideal Weight Calculator determines the lower and upper bounds of a healthy weight range by calculating the weights that correspond to the lower (18.5) and upper (23.9) limits of the healthy BMI for the user's specified height.

Mathematical Derivation:

1. Convert Height to Meters: `height_m = height_cm / 100`

2. Calculate Lower Bound Weight:

  • The formula for BMI is: `BMI = Weight (kg) / (Height (m))²`
  • Rearranging to find weight: `Weight (kg) = BMI * (Height (m))²`
  • Lower Bound Weight = `18.5 * (height_m)²`

3. Calculate Upper Bound Weight:

  • Upper Bound Weight = `23.9 * (height_m)²`

The primary result displayed is this range, with age and sex used for context and potential minor adjustments in perception, though the core BMI calculation is height-dependent.

Practical Examples (Real-World Use Cases)

Understanding the Chinese ideal weight concept is crucial for making informed health decisions. Here are a couple of practical examples:

Example 1: A Young Adult Female

  • User Input: Height: 165 cm, Age: 25, Sex: Female
  • Calculation:
    • Height in meters: 1.65 m
    • Lower Bound Weight: 18.5 * (1.65)² ≈ 50.4 kg
    • Upper Bound Weight: 23.9 * (1.65)² ≈ 65.1 kg
    • Calculated BMI at 50.4 kg: 50.4 / (1.65)² ≈ 18.5
    • Calculated BMI at 65.1 kg: 65.1 / (1.65)² ≈ 23.9
  • Calculator Output:
    • Ideal Weight Range: 50.4 kg – 65.1 kg
    • BMI: 18.5 – 23.9
    • Interpretation: A 25-year-old female who is 165 cm tall has an ideal weight range between approximately 50.4 kg and 65.1 kg to maintain a healthy BMI relevant for East Asian populations. This range allows for personal variation while staying within optimal health parameters.

Example 2: A Middle-Aged Male

  • User Input: Height: 178 cm, Age: 45, Sex: Male
  • Calculation:
    • Height in meters: 1.78 m
    • Lower Bound Weight: 18.5 * (1.78)² ≈ 58.7 kg
    • Upper Bound Weight: 23.9 * (1.78)² ≈ 75.8 kg
    • Calculated BMI at 58.7 kg: 58.7 / (1.78)² ≈ 18.5
    • Calculated BMI at 75.8 kg: 75.8 / (1.78)² ≈ 23.9
  • Calculator Output:
    • Ideal Weight Range: 58.7 kg – 75.8 kg
    • BMI: 18.5 – 23.9
    • Interpretation: A 45-year-old male who is 178 cm tall falls within the ideal weight range of approximately 58.7 kg to 75.8 kg. This range supports good health and reduces the risk associated with being underweight or overweight. Age is noted but the primary range is based on height and the target BMI.

Key Factors That Affect Ideal Weight Results

While the Chinese Ideal Weight Calculator provides a valuable estimate, several factors influence an individual's optimal weight and overall health:

  1. Body Composition: Muscle is denser than fat. An individual with higher muscle mass might weigh more but still be healthy and lean. BMI alone doesn't distinguish between muscle and fat.
  2. Bone Density and Frame Size: People with naturally larger bone structures or denser bones may weigh more than those with smaller frames, even at a similar height.
  3. Age: Metabolic rate can change with age. While the calculator uses age mainly for context, very young or elderly individuals might have slightly different optimal ranges.
  4. Genetics: Inherited traits can influence body shape, metabolism, and predisposition to certain weight ranges or body fat distribution.
  5. Activity Level: Highly athletic individuals may have different body composition, requiring a nuanced view of ideal weight beyond simple height-based calculations. Understanding Fitness Levels can provide more context.
  6. Overall Health Status: Chronic conditions, hormonal imbalances, or certain medications can affect weight regulation and what constitutes a healthy weight for an individual.
  7. Cultural and Ethnic Background: While this calculator is tailored for Chinese populations with a specific BMI range, other ethnic groups may have slightly different optimal BMI ranges due to genetic and physiological variations.
  8. Lifestyle Factors: Diet, sleep quality, stress management, and environmental factors all play a role in maintaining a healthy weight and body composition.

For a comprehensive understanding, it's always best to combine calculator results with professional medical advice and an assessment of personal health goals.

Frequently Asked Questions (FAQ)

Q1: Is the ideal weight the same for men and women?

A: While the core BMI calculation is unisex, the ideal weight range is primarily determined by height. However, body composition differences between sexes (e.g., muscle mass, body fat percentage) mean that men and women of the same height might have slightly different perceived "ideal" body shapes, even if their calculated weight ranges overlap.

Q2: Why does the calculator use a BMI range of 18.5-23.9?

A: This specific BMI range is often considered optimal for East Asian populations, including Chinese individuals, as research suggests that health risks associated with weight may begin to increase at lower BMI levels compared to some Western populations.

Q3: Can I use this calculator if I am very muscular?

A: The calculator is based on BMI, which doesn't differentiate between muscle and fat. Very muscular individuals might have a BMI that falls into the "overweight" category but could still be very healthy. Use the results as a guide and consider your body composition.

Q4: How does age affect my ideal weight?

A: While the primary calculation is based on height, age can influence metabolic rate and body composition. The calculator includes age for context, but the healthy weight range itself is mainly derived from height and the target BMI.

Q5: What if my current weight is outside the ideal range?

A: If your current weight is outside the calculated healthy range, it doesn't automatically mean you are unhealthy. However, it's a good indicator to review your lifestyle, diet, and activity levels. Consult a healthcare professional for personalized advice.

Q6: Is this calculator suitable for children or adolescents?

A: This calculator is designed for adults. Ideal weight calculations for children and adolescents are different and require age-specific growth charts and considerations, often assessed by pediatricians.

Q7: How often should I check my ideal weight?

A: Your ideal weight range doesn't change significantly unless your height does. However, monitoring your actual weight and body composition periodically (e.g., every few months) can help you maintain a healthy lifestyle.

Q8: What is the difference between ideal weight and target weight?

A: "Ideal weight" typically refers to a healthy range determined by scientific metrics like BMI. "Target weight" is a more personal goal, which might be within the ideal range but specific to an individual's aspirations, fitness goals, or recommendations from a health professional.

Q9: Does 'Chinese Ideal Weight' prioritize being thin?

A: While cultural perceptions can sometimes lean towards valuing a slimmer physique, the "ideal weight" calculated here is rooted in achieving a BMI range (18.5-23.9) that is scientifically linked to better health outcomes and reduced risk of weight-related diseases for East Asian populations. It emphasizes health over extreme thinness.
